The relationship of traumatic life events and problem solving skills with suicidal behavior

Abstract (EN)
The aim of this study to investigate the prevalence and the relationship of traumatic life events and problem solving skills to suicidal behavior in a group of university students. The study was conducted with 624 (64.9% women) students from Adnan Menderes University. Students who accepted participation filled in a questionnaire that contained questions about socio-demographics, suicidal behavior, traumatic experiences questionnaire and a social problem solving inventory-revised. In the results of the analyses, of the students, 25.7 % reported having thought and 9 % reported having attempted suicide. 59.5 % of the sample experienced at least one traumatic life-event. Additionally, analyses showed that inefficient problem solving and experiencing of traumatic life events were independent predictors of both suicidal thoughts and attempts. In accordance with diathesis-stress model, both suicidal thoughts and attempts were found to be most frequent among persons with inefficient problem solving skills and who were also exposed to a large amount of traumatic life events. Findings indicate that inefficient problem solving and experiencing of large amount of traumatic life events together may be predictors of both suicidal ideation and attempts.
